X-ray and MRI referrals at Adobe Foot and Ankle Specialist

Foot and ankle care leans on imaging, so Adobe Foot and Ankle Specialist faxes an X-ray or MRI referral to a radiology center and receives the report back — a fracture, a stress injury, or osteomyelitis confirmed on film. The imaging referral should state the clinical indication — the suspected fracture, stress injury, or infection — so the radiologist knows what to look for. Put the patient identifiers on every page so the study is matched.

The referral packet Adobe Foot and Ankle Specialist receives

The everyday inbound document at Adobe Foot and Ankle Specialist is a referral: a primary care office or endocrinologist forwarding a foot complaint with the chart notes that justify it. A diabetic foot referral moves faster when the A1C, the vascular status, and any wound history are on the page. A quick call helps Adobe Foot and Ankle Specialist watch for an urgent foot referral.
